vinimoreira commited on
Commit
bcbc37c
·
verified ·
1 Parent(s): 332110d

udate prompt_template

Browse files

update prompt_template.

Files changed (1) hide show
  1. src/generation/prompt_templates.py +29 -2
src/generation/prompt_templates.py CHANGED
@@ -1,5 +1,3 @@
1
- # src/generation/prompt_templates.py
2
-
3
  helpdesk_prompt = """
4
  Contexto técnico:
5
  {context}
@@ -42,3 +40,32 @@ Responda a pergunta: {query}
42
 
43
  Se possível, inclua links úteis para mais informações.
44
  """
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
  helpdesk_prompt = """
2
  Contexto técnico:
3
  {context}
 
40
 
41
  Se possível, inclua links úteis para mais informações.
42
  """
43
+
44
+ # Seus prompts antigos podem continuar aqui, sem problemas.
45
+ helpdesk_prompt = """
46
+ Contexto técnico:
47
+ {context}
48
+
49
+ Com base nisso, responda à seguinte pergunta:
50
+ {query}
51
+ """
52
+
53
+ RAG_PROMPT_TEMPLATE = """[INST]
54
+ Sua tarefa é agir como um assistente de helpdesk de TI objetivo e técnico. Você deve responder à pergunta do usuário usando estritamente as informações contidas na seção <CONTEXTO>.
55
+
56
+ **REGRAS ABSOLUTAS:**
57
+ 1. Responda SEMPRE em Português do Brasil.
58
+ 2. NUNCA mencione a palavra "contexto" ou "fonte" na sua resposta. Apenas use a informação.
59
+ 3. NUNCA repita a pergunta do usuário. Gere apenas a resposta direta para a pergunta.
60
+ 4. Se a informação não estiver no contexto, responda EXATAMENTE com a frase: "Não encontrei informações sobre isso na minha base de dados."
61
+ 5. Baseie-se 100% no texto dentro de <CONTEXTO>. Não adicione nenhuma informação externa.
62
+
63
+ <CONTEXTO>
64
+ {context}
65
+ </CONTEXTO>
66
+
67
+ <PERGUNTA>
68
+ {query}
69
+ </PERGUNTA>
70
+ [/INST]
71
+ """